A brewing tradition since 1887.
Welcome at Brewery De Block! A long brewing tradition makes a tie between the past and the present. Quality is the real and only foundation for all our beers, they may listen to names as: Satan Black, Satan Gold, Satan Red, Kastaar, Abbeybeer Tripple Dendermonde. They are loved by such a great deal of connoisseurs all over the world, as well in Europe, Japan, Canada, United States, Australia, ... and this makes the job worth to do.

Imported from my RateBeer account as Satan Red (by De Block Brouwerij):
Aroma: 6/10, Appearance: 2/5, Taste: 5/10, Palate: 2/5, Overall: 10/20, MyTotalScore: 2.5/5

30/VI/14 - 33cl bottle from Willems (Grobbendonk) @ Bouvier's place, football WC match Belgium-USA - BB: 27/IX/15 (2014-688)

Clear dark orange beer, small creamy off-white head, little stable, adhesive. Aroma: very fruity, sweet and sugary, peaches, some banana, bit oxidized. MF: ok carbon, medium body. Taste: sweet start, caramel, bit malty, pretty oxidized, almonds, little bitter, sourish. Aftertaste: orange peel, lemon rind, bitter, very oxidized, sweet, some caramel. And this beer had still one year before expiration? Madness...

Imported from my RateBeer account as Satan Black (by De Block Brouwerij):
Aroma: 6/10, Appearance: 3/5, Taste: 5/10, Palate: 2/5, Overall: 10/20, MyTotalScore: 2.6/5

30/VI/14 - 33cl bottle from Geers (Oostakker) shared with Bobochamp @ De Hopduvel (Gent) - BB: 28/V/17 (2014-682)

Clear purple brown beer, creamy beige irregular head, pretty stable, bit adhesive. Aroma: spicy, grains, horse stable, bit dirty, metallic. MF: too much carbon, medium to light body. Taste: bit sweet, sourish touch, caramel, spicy, little bitter. Aftertaste: caramel, some citrus, bitter, hint of chocolate, metallic. Meh. Would have been a chance for De Block to surpass themselves as a brewery, by making something more bold, stout-like. An opportunity not taken, alas.
